    BEIT HANOUN, GAZA STRIP - DECEMBER 01: Palestinian old men, supporters of Hamas, take part in a rally to celebrate the withdrawl of Israeli troops earlier in the week after a ceasefire, in Beit Hanoun, northern Gaza Strip, Friday, Dec. 1, 2006.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as convened the PLO's top decision-making body on Friday to map out a strategy after declaring that talks to form a more moderate government with ruling Hamas militants had collapsed. The arabic on headband reads "There is no God But God," and "Al Qassam Brigades." (photo by Fox Gaza/ Flash90

    BEIT HANOUN, GAZA STRIP - DECEMBER 01: Palestinians women carrying pictures of the martyrs of the battle of Beit Hanoun, during a rally to celebrate the withdrawl of Israeli troops earlier in the week after a cease fire in Beit Hanoun, northern Gaza Strip, Friday, Dec. 1, 2006.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as convened the PLO's top decision-making body on Friday to map out a strategy after declaring that talks to form a more moderate government with ruling Hamas militants had collapsed. Abbas has two options, both problematic for him _ fire the Hamas-led government or hold a national referendum on whether to call early elections. (photo by Fox Gaza/ Flash90
